Output 63833120b0df88ddd822308e3a022f641d24d799b2f86ceca9f23f0f57e14792:1

value
42680859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5a4909a5195a9f3fdef73bd2e18b523681f5f5b OP_EQUALVERIFY OP_CHECKSIG
address
1MwEt6Z2L5YymjsFr2489oJkqYdq4uMvfB
transaction
63833120b0df88ddd822308e3a022f641d24d799b2f86ceca9f23f0f57e14792
spent
true